MySQL如何刪除索引名?
索引是MySQL中非常重要的一部分,它可以提高查詢的效率。但是在某些情況下,我們可能需要刪除某個索引。那么怎么刪除索引名呢?下面就為大家介紹一下。
一、查看索引名
在刪除索引之前,我們需要先查看一下索引名,以確保我們刪除的是正確的索引??梢酝ㄟ^以下命令查看:
```dexame;
ame是你要查看索引的表名。
二、刪除索引名
刪除索引名的命令如下:
```dexdexameame;
dexameame是該索引所在的表名。
需要注意的是,刪除索引會導致查詢效率下降,因此在刪除索引之前,需要仔細考慮是否真的需要刪除。
ts的表,其中有一個名為idx_age的索引,我們要刪除這個索引,可以按照以下步驟進行:
1. 查看索引名
```dexts;
輸出結果如下:
+----------+------------+----------+--------------+-------------+-----------+-------------+----------+--------+------+------------+---------+---------------+iqueamedexnamealitydexmentdexment
+----------+------------+----------+--------------+-------------+-----------+-------------+----------+--------+------+------------+---------+---------------+ts | 0 | PRIMARY | 1 | id | A | 5 | NULL | NULL | | BTREE | | |ts | 1 | idx_age | 1 | age | A | 5 | NULL | NULL | YES | BTREE
+----------+------------+----------+--------------+-------------+-----------+-------------+----------+--------+------+------------+---------+---------------+
可以看到,我們要刪除的索引名為idx_age。
2. 刪除索引名
```dexts;
執行成功后,該索引就被刪除了。
通過以上步驟,我們可以輕松地刪除MySQL中的索引名。但是需要注意的是,刪除索引會對查詢效率產生影響,因此在刪除之前需要仔細考慮。